To design a captivating outdoor space that seamlessly blends purpose with aesthetic appeal, consider implementing fundamental landscape design principles. Begin by establishing your desired style and objectives. Embrace the existing features of your yard, such as mature trees or present structures, to guide your design.
- Pay attention to balance by selecting plants and hardscaping elements that are harmonious with the size of your yard.
- Incorporate a variety of textures, colors, and plant types to produce visual interest and depth.
- Consider the flow of movement through your space by planning walkways, patios, and seating areas that encourage relaxation and gathering.
By using these principles, you can transform your outdoor space into a serene oasis that serves as an extension of your home.

Nurturing Landscapes: Irrigation Systems for Thriving Landscapes
A well-designed irrigation system is the backbone of a thriving landscape. It supplies the essential water your plants require to flourish, stimulating healthy growth and vibrant vegetation. By tailoring water delivery, you can provide for a lush and picturesque outdoor space that boasts in health and beauty.
There are various kinds of irrigation systems available, each with its own advantages. Sprinkler systems are popular choices, offering efficient water delivery to your garden.
Evaluate factors such as the scope of your landscape, terrain, and access to water when selecting the best system for your needs.

Conserve Water Through Irrigation: Sustainable Irrigation Strategies
In a world grappling with limited water resources, implementing sustainable irrigation strategies is crucial for preserving our precious water assets. By utilizing smart techniques, we can enhance crop yields while reducing water consumption.
One effective strategy is localized watering, which channels water directly to the plant roots, reducing evaporation and runoff. Another beneficial approach is soil moisture monitoring, which allows farmers to effectively regulate irrigation based on real-time soil conditions.
Furthermore, implementing mulching can help retain soil moisture, reducing the need for frequent irrigation. By incorporating these sustainable practices, we can guarantee a productive agricultural industry while protecting our water resources for future generations.
